Stack-based Buffer Overflow in GitHub repository vim/vim prior to 9.0.
{ "vanir_signatures": [ { "source": "https://github.com/vim/vim/commit/54e5fed6d27b747ff152cdb6edfb72ff60e70939", "signature_type": "Line", "target": { "file": "src/version.c" }, "id": "CVE-2022-2304-32487e2b", "digest": { "threshold": 0.9, "line_hashes": [ "146200493773228420153804765641940418619", "79572535301798292149071721624660417338", "140595249767800188412641963661190541819", "155103223906393073025333009244971547307" ] }, "deprecated": false, "signature_version": "v1" }, { "source": "https://github.com/vim/vim/commit/54e5fed6d27b747ff152cdb6edfb72ff60e70939", "signature_type": "Function", "target": { "file": "src/spell.c", "function": "spell_dump_compl" }, "id": "CVE-2022-2304-75a78315", "digest": { "function_hash": "214900707160786871459149740068279937802", "length": 2786.0 }, "deprecated": false, "signature_version": "v1" }, { "source": "https://github.com/vim/vim/commit/54e5fed6d27b747ff152cdb6edfb72ff60e70939", "signature_type": "Line", "target": { "file": "src/spell.c" }, "id": "CVE-2022-2304-e2f56171", "digest": { "threshold": 0.9, "line_hashes": [ "154193152055624827965929662057826148879", "46848925296492394234534743993923545587", "135787899491688434317726425713894343456", "214835611860955575108334028616867358819", "159487895445468317346352267068904224475" ] }, "deprecated": false, "signature_version": "v1" } ] }